DEC = Direct Entry Captain. Go directly to the left seat if you have 1,000 hrs 121 time.

I think it’ll be a thing after 20-01 is out. Anyone interested will have to be happy with IAH, IAH or IAH only and about 5-6 yrs of reserve. So no more than 11 days off a month (12 on a 31 day month). If that sounds like something you’re interested in, welcome aboard!

Anywhere you apply to be a DEC will be an extended stay on reserve unless there’s explosive growth or a flow to take senior people above you off the list. Envoy’s DEC’s are looking at 1.5 - 3 yrs of reserve, maybe more.
